Potters Mills Neighborhood Market Intelligence

Overview

Potters Mills is a historic and primarily residential neighborhood on the west side of Binghamton, NY. Known for its quiet, tree-lined streets and a mix of architectural styles, it offers a suburban feel with close proximity to downtown amenities and major routes like Route 17.

Housing & Real Estate

The neighborhood features a variety of housing, including well-maintained single-family homes, classic American Foursquares, and some multi-unit properties. With a median home value of approximately $282,800, Potters Mills represents a stable and attractive market within the greater Binghamton area.

Schools & Education

Families in Potters Mills are served by the Binghamton City School District, with students often attending nearby schools like Calvin Coolidge Elementary. The neighborhood's location also provides convenient access to higher education institutions, including Binghamton University, which is just a short drive away.

Parks & Recreation

Residents enjoy easy access to recreational spaces like nearby Ely Park, which offers walking trails, golf, and sports facilities. The neighborhood's own smaller green spaces and sidewalks contribute to an active, community-oriented atmosphere for families and individuals alike.

Local Dining & Shopping

While primarily residential, Potters Mills is just minutes from the commercial corridors of Main Street and the Vestal Parkway. This provides a wide array of dining options, from casual local eateries to national chains, as well as convenient shopping at nearby plazas and the Oakdale Mall.

Who Lives Here

The neighborhood is home to a mix of families, professionals, and long-time residents, creating a diverse community fabric. With a median household income around $59,092, it reflects a solidly middle-class demographic that values the area's stability and historic charm.
